There was a trend, for a time, where birthday gifts and parties for kids had to be as extravagant as possible. When it comes to adults, as long as the budget truly allows, I'm all for wonderfully huge gifts. When it comes to kids, however, I think it's best for them to understand and appreciate simpler pleasures. That way their happiness isn't contingent on things. After all, it's best for them to be able to know happiness that's not dependent on outright materialistic frenzy! Kiddy birthday parties, too, for a time, got to be huge productions, with themes, and big, costly surprises…they had to be real events, sometimes even with rented venues. Some parents seemed at a loss for how to top one year's party with the next, or how to top the parties mounted by other parents for their children. Perhaps one of the effects of the economic downturn is the of curbing some excesses such as these. Perhaps it's an opportunity to rediscover the joys of a good old picnic, or parties where the kids enjoy playing good old games rather than being entertained.
